Why is it important for luxury brands to maintain their creator-led status?

Maintaining a creator-led status is essential for luxury brands because it helps preserve their uniqueness and fosters continuous innovation. Luxury brands often rely on the vision and creativity of their founders or designers, whose distinct perspectives and artistic expression are integral to the brand's identity. This connection to a creator allows the brand to stand out in a saturated market, enabling it to offer exclusive and innovative products that resonate with consumers seeking unique, high-quality items.

By championing the creator-led approach, luxury brands can create a narrative that emphasizes their craftsmanship, heritage, and the individual artistry behind their offerings. This authenticity not only attracts discerning customers but also builds emotional connections and brand loyalty, setting these luxury entities apart from more mainstream or mass-market competitors.

In contrast, focusing solely on market trends might undermine a brand's core values, while mere consumer satisfaction doesn't inherently guarantee a brand's unique positioning. While group involvement can be beneficial, it often lacks the visionary direction that a strong creator provides in a luxury context. Thus, the emphasis on preserving uniqueness and innovation through a creator-led status ultimately strengthens the brand's appeal and reinforces its luxury positioning.
